你查询的IP:[117.60.180.128]  地理位置:中国–江苏–苏州电信

最新查询119.10.203.8 219.128.160.23 119.8.132.55 117.24.193.220 121.192.72.181 167.139.114.185 121.8.14.12 114.64.26.187 123.101.68.57 117.60.180.128 124.240.128.161 122.48.99.83 219.82.196.103 117.8.3.234 61.232.59.235 116.212.160.19 198.17.7.116 124.249.29.151 122.49.63.229 116.192.157.11 121.32.13.46 203.161.192.218 124.126.176.242 124.28.192.104 61.47.128.103 222.176.83.46 202.142.16.59 203.95.96.185 222.240.85.176 203.208.32.31 116.214.128.127